WARNING

To prevent SERIOUS INJURY, DEATH or PROPERTY DAMAGE:

  • ALWAYS read, understand and follow warnings and instructions for your hitch BEFORE installation. Keep for future reference.
  • DO NOT cut, weld or modify this receiver.
  • CHECK all fasteners are tight and your hitch is securely mounted to your vehicle periodically.
  • ALWAYS read, understand and follow all warnings and instructions for your vehicle and for other accessories you will use with your hitch BEFORE use.
  • LOAD the trailer heavier in front.
  • DO NOT exceed lower of towing vehicle manufacturer’s rating or:
Hitch Type Max Gross Trailer Weight Max Tongue Weight
Weight Carrying 4500 lb. (2043kg) 675 lb. (306 kg)
Weight Distributing 4500 lb. (2043kg) 675 lb. (306 kg)
  • ALWAYS wear your seatbelt.
  • SLOW DOWN when towing, NEVER exceed any posted speed limit.
  • If EXCESS SWAY occurs, take your foot off the gas pedal and hold the steering wheel as steady as possible. DO NOT apply your brakes and DO NOT speed up.

Installation Instructions

PART NUMBERS: 76557, 84557, CQT76557

Fastener Kit: 76557F

1| Qty. (2)| Carriage bolt
7/16’’-14 x 2.00, GR5
---|---|---
2| Qty. (2)| Hex nut
7/16’’ -14 GR2
3| Qty. (2)| Conical  washer
7/16’’
4| Qty. (2)| Spacer
.250 x 1.00 x 3.00
5| Qty. (2)| Pull wire
7/16’’
6| Qty. (1)| Bolt
M12x1.75x70mm CL 8.8
7| Qty. (4)| Conical washer
1/2″
8| Qty. (2)| Spacer
.250” x 1.50” x 3.00”
9| Qty. (1)| Spacer
.375” x 1.50” x 3.00”
10| Qty. (3)| Bolt
M12x1.75×40 CL 8.8
| |
---|---|---
A. Insert bolt and Block into frame| B. Align block on access hole| C. Pull bolt thru block

  1. Lower exhaust muffler: Use soapy water to lubricate exhaust rubber hangers. Using exhaust removal pliers, remove (2) rubber hangers. Note: Be sure to support exhaust before removing rubber hangers.

  2. Remove bottom appearance panel: Using 7 mm socket and flat head screwdriver, remove (8) screws and (1) rivets from bottom appearance panel on passenger side of vehicle.
    Return (2) screws to vehicle owner.

  3. Remove Bolts: Using 19 mm socket, remove (2) M12 bolts from bottom surface of chassis both side of vehicle both sides of vehicle, see Figure 3.

  4. Install hitch: a) Feed (1) carriage bolt ① and (1) spacer ④ through the access hole using the pull wires ⑤ both side of vehicle, see Figure 1. Leave pull wires attached. Raise the hitch and feed pull wire previously installed through hitch bracket slot. Remove pull wires and loosely install (1) 7/16” conical washer ③ and (1) 7/16” hex nut  ② to hitch both sides. b) Using (3) spacers ⑧⑧⑨, insert between offset bracket tab and mounting surface and loosely secure hitch using (1) M12 bolt ⑥ and (1) 1/2“  conical washer ⑦ on driver side, see Figure 1. c) Using (3) M12 bolts ⑩ and (3) 1/2“ conical washers ⑦, loosely install into remaining (3) holes to secure hitch to  vehicle.

  5. Tighten all M12 fasteners with torque wrench to 68 Ft.-Lb (92 N*M).

  6. Tighten all 7/16‘’ fasteners with torque wrench to 50 Ft.-Lb. (68 N*M).

  7. Trim appearance panel: Using die grinder, trim area shown in Figure 2. Reinstall appearance panel using (6) screws and (1) rivet removed in step 2.

  8. Reinstall the rubber hangers and exhaust muffler.
    Proper torque is needed to keep the hitch secure to the vehicle when towing.

Note: check hitch frequently, making sure all fasteners and ball are properly tightened. If hitch is removed, plug all holes in trunk pan or other body panels to prevent entry of water and exhaust fumes. A hitch or ball which has been damaged should be removed and replaced. Observe safety precautions when working beneath a vehicle and wear eye protection. Do not cut access or attachment holes with a torch. This product complies with safety specifications and requirements for connecting devices and towing systems of the state of New York, V.E.S.C. Regulation V-5 and SAE J684.
